Lightbulb Patriots Expected to Tender LB Woods

Ian's Daily Blog - The Boston Herald reported on Tuesday that the Patriots are expected to give linebacker Pierre*Woods a second-round tender, just as they did last season. According to the report the deal would pay him $1.759 million in 2010, which is a raise from the $1.545 million he received in 2009. Odds are pretty good that should be enough [...]
